>>> I also have had a poor experience with Discover's warranty. 
>>> I installed 3x 7.4kWh AES batteries for an off-grid customer in 2020. I registered  the warranty for all three within a few weeks of installation. Fast forward to 2023, the original customer sold the property and the new owner asked me out to troubleshoot a storage issue. One battery had failed to due a faulty BMS. Discover refused to honor the warranty because the property had changed hands (they tie the warranty to the original registered owner), and the new owner was stuck buying a new battery. 
>>>  
>>> Discover did offer the replacement at a slightly discounted price but I thought it was lousy to find out that a 10-year warranty product suddenly has no warranty if the property is ever sold. It really turned me off, and I was left with the  feeling that I might have had better luck getting a warranty replacement if I had never registered the batteries at all.
